What is Keyword Cannibalization and Why is it Important in SEO?
Keyword cannibalization refers to a situation where multiple pages on a website are targeting the same or similar keywords. This can occur unintentionally when different pages are optimized for the same keywords, causing them to compete against each other in search engine rankings. The consequence of keyword cannibalization is that it weakens the overall SEO performance of the website. Instead of having one page ranking highly for a particular keyword, multiple pages are diluting the SEO value, resulting in lowered visibility and reduced organic traffic.
Understanding the importance of keyword cannibalization in SEO is crucial for website owners and digital marketers. When pages on a website are cannibalizing each other, it not only confuses search engines but also hampers user experience. With multiple pages targeting the same keywords, search engines struggle to determine which page is the most relevant and authoritative, leading to lower rankings. Moreover, it creates a confusing and redundant experience for users when they encounter multiple pages with similar content in search results. Therefore, identifying and addressing keyword cannibalization issues is essential for improving SEO performance and ensuring a seamless user experience on a website.
Identifying Keyword Cannibalization Issues on Your Website
Identifying keyword cannibalization issues on your website is crucial for effective SEO optimization. These issues occur when multiple pages on your website compete for the same keyword, leading to confusion for search engines and ultimately affecting your search rankings. The first step in identifying keyword cannibalization is conducting a comprehensive keyword analysis. This involves reviewing your website to identify pages that target similar or identical keywords. Look for instances where multiple pages are optimized for the same keyword, as this can create a cannibalization problem. Additionally, pay attention to pages that are closely related in content or topic, as they may inadvertently compete for the same keywords. Regularly monitoring and assessing your website for keyword cannibalization can help identify and address any potential issues, ensuring that your SEO efforts are focused and optimized.
Once you have identified potential instances of keyword cannibalization on your website, it is important to evaluate the impact on your SEO performance. Analyze the search rankings and organic traffic of the affected pages to determine if there is a correlation between the cannibalization issue and a drop in performance. Additionally, assess the overall visibility of your website on search engine result pages (SERPs) for the targeted keywords. If you notice a decline in rankings or reduced visibility for these keywords, it is likely that keyword cannibalization is negatively affecting your SEO efforts. Properly identifying the impact of keyword cannibalization is crucial in recognizing the significance of resolving these issues. Once you have a clear understanding of the impact, you can proceed to implement effective strategies to overcome keyword cannibalization and boost your SEO performance.

Strategies to Resolve Keyword Cannibalization Problems
To resolve keyword cannibalization problems on your website, it is crucial to implement effective strategies. The first strategy is to conduct a thorough audit of your website’s content. This involves identifying the pages that are targeting the same or similar keywords and determining which page should be the primary focus. By consolidating similar content and optimizing it on a single page, you can prevent cannibalization and ensure that search engines understand the intended focus of each page.
Another effective strategy is to optimize your content to avoid keyword cannibalization. This can be achieved by conducting comprehensive keyword research and incorporating a diverse range of long-tail keywords into your content. By utilizing variations of your target keyword and focusing on different aspects or angles of the topic, you can create unique and valuable content that caters to different search queries. Additionally, optimizing meta tags, headings, and internal anchor text with relevant keywords will help search engines understand the context and relevance of each page.

Optimizing Content to Avoid Keyword Cannibalization
Optimizing content is crucial in order to avoid keyword cannibalization and maximize SEO performance. One way to do this is by conducting a comprehensive content audit to identify any potential cannibalization issues. This involves analyzing all the pages on your website that target similar keywords and assessing whether they are competing against each other in search results.
Once you have identified the problematic pages, the next step is to optimize the content to ensure each page has a unique focus keyword and purpose. This can be achieved by carefully crafting titles, meta descriptions, headings, and content that clearly differentiate each page from one another. Additionally, it is important to ensure that internal linking is optimized, with relevant anchor text directing users to the appropriate page. By fine-tuning your content and internal linking strategy, you can effectively avoid keyword cannibalization and improve the overall visibility and performance of your website in search engine rankings.

Monitoring and Tracking Keyword Performance
Monitoring and tracking keyword performance is a crucial aspect of any successful SEO strategy. By regularly monitoring how your targeted keywords are performing in search engine results pages (SERPs), you can gain valuable insights into the effectiveness of your optimization efforts. This information allows you to make data-driven decisions and adjust your strategy accordingly.
One way to monitor keyword performance is by utilizing tools like Google Analytics and Google Search Console. These tools provide valuable data regarding the search volume, impressions, click-through rates, and average position of your target keywords. By analyzing this data, you can identify trends, spot any fluctuations in keyword rankings, and determine which keywords are driving the most traffic to your website. Additionally, monitoring keyword performance can help you identify any potential keyword cannibalization issues and take appropriate actions to resolve them.
